Jacinthe Flore

Jacinthe Flore is a postdoctoral research fellow in the ARC Centre of Excellence for Automated Decision-Making & Society, School of Media and Communication at RMIT University. She is an interdisciplinary researcher broadly interested in the social and political implications of advanced technologies in the areas of health, mental health, and gender and sexuality. Jacinthe’s research draws on more-than-human perspectives, health sociology, and media and communication. She is also a chief investigator on the ARC Linkage Project Borderline personality as social phenomena (2021-2024).
